Google to Slash 4,000 Jobs at Motorola Division
http://www.huffingtonpost.com/huff-wires/20120813/us-google-motorola-layoffs
"Google Inc. is making its largest round of layoffs ever as it announced plans to cut about 4,000 jobs at Motorola Mobility just three months after buying the struggling cellphone pioneer."

Re: Google to Slash 4,000 Jobs at Motorola Division
I read another report on this yesterday. Quite a few of these jobs will be in Europe, but it's still going to hurt. Unfortunately what happens in Europe doesn't stay in Europe, it hurts us too.
They are also planning on closing a plant in Illinois and moving to Chicago, that too has an effect on those with transportation issues.
